Vicenzo Barra (Avellino , 1977) is PhD in “Storia dell’Europa mediterranea dall’antichità all’età contemporanea”(Italy, 2006) and in Contemporary History at the University of Santiago de Compostela (Spain, 2020); Professor of Contemporary History at Università Telematica Pegaso (Naples), he has dealt with the history of the provincial institutions and the local ruling classes of the Italian Mezzogiorno in the liberal and fascist era, until the referendum of 2 June 1946. His research focused on the comparative history of the liberal Spanish system of the Bourbon Restoration and the Italian system since the fall of the Destra Storica. His line of research also includes the study of how daily life was "archived" and represented in the egodocuments, especially through the study of the epistolaries with a micro-historical approach.
